Answer:
<h2>L=203 yards</h2><h2>W=52 yards</h2>
Step-by-step explanation:
Step one:
given data
perimeter= 510 yards
let the width be x, width=x
length= (4x-5)-----quadruple mean 4 times
Step two:
the expression for perimeter is
P=2L+2W
510=2(4x-5)+2x
510=8x-10+2x
510+10=8x+2x
520=10x
divide both sides by 10
x=520/10
x=52
the width is 52 yards
the lenght is (4x-5)
L=4(52)-5
L=208-5
L=203 yards
